MPS NSD Challenge #4

This challenge made me think for awhile and then I came up with using the Jubilee cricut cartridge. I bought because I think the price was really low and then never used it. So this challenge was to use something you least like or least use on your project. The background paper is a piece of scraps I had from other cards. The star is from George and Basic Shapes and the "YOU ROCK" is actually a cut from the Jubilee cartridge, I was surprised to find that sentiment on there because most cuts have to do with houses and such. The card is actually a birthday card for my neice who is not a girly girl so thats where the colors come into play. Thanks for stopping by and have a great week.
